Engine system failure ford c max Source Source Source Source Source Source Source Source Source Source Read Also: Engine system failure ford focus diesel Engine system failure ford focus c max Engine system failure ford focus Ford focus 2006 engine system failure Ford focus 1.8tdci engine system failure Ford focus c-max engine system failure